加入收藏 | 设为首页 | 会员中心 | 我要投稿 宁德站长网 (https://www.0593zz.com/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

深究下去站长网 aspzz.cn才发现了这个项目

发布时间:2016-10-30 17:40:10 所属栏目:PHP教程 来源:Scholer's Blog
导读:副标题#e# 起首你 应该 是在用 PHP 5.3 以上的版本, interactive debugger and REPL for PHP. PsySH相同 Python 的 IDLE 的一个 PHP 的交互运行情形,已经是很好用的了,大概有人以为 PHP 就是一个模板引擎、就 应该 手写 SQL ,不要被 这些 话所困扰。 这
副标题[/!--empirenews.page--]

起首你应该是在用 PHP 5.3 以上的版本, interactive debugger and REPL for PHP. PsySH相同 Python 的 IDLE 的一个 PHP 的交互运行情形,已经是很好用的了,大概有人以为 PHP 就是一个模板引擎、就应该手写 SQL ,不要被这些话所困扰。

这个组织的目标并不是汇报你你应该怎么做。

PSR 的一系列尺度文档由php-fig(PHP Framework Interop Group)草拟和投票决策,我存眷的有 Symfony 以及 Phalcon (C说话实现),不外也提供了支持 Smarty 和 Twig 的扩展。

但干净的看起来更惬意, 你应该看过PHP The Right Way,Laravel 5 的artisan tinker的成果是通过它来实现的,其语法过于伟大,只是最近在几个开源框架中都看到了.php_cs的文件,Twig和 Symfony 以及上文提到的 php-cs-fixer 都是 SensioLabs 的作品,项目内里尚有一些太长的正则表达式、太伟大的实现,只是一些主流的框架之间彼此协商和约定,说真话我并不是太喜好,但研究一下。

这着实写起来并欠悦目,我但愿后头能将 Blade 的理会部门单独抽取出来做一个轻量的实现,尚有一些可选的编码气魄威风凛凛是 Symfony 的类型,偶然辰也由不得本身选择,要说甜头我也说不上来,好用的模板引擎 (Blade) 亦或有一个颜值较量高的文档(社区看到的话)等等,是时辰该进级了, Larval 的焦点实现是一个容器(Container)以及 PHP 的反射类(ReflectionClass)(Yii 2 也是一样),但着实远不止此,此刻还只是简朴的实现。

composer 是通过spl_autoload_register要领注册一个自动加载要领实现扩展类和文件的加载的, PHP 5.3 提供了定名空间,它不只仅是用于安装扩展, 也许有人认为纠结代码气魄威风凛凛的题目着实没有出格大的须要,穷究下去才发明白这个项目。

一时好奇,http-kernel和http-foundation在 Laravel 中也有被担任过来直接行使, how to build your application. 2. Composer Composer is a tool for dependency management in PHP. It allows you to declare the libraries your project depends on and it will manage (install/update) them for you. composer 和 Pear、Pecl 都差异,在写法上相同 Python 的 import, 我们都知道 PHP 引入文件要通过include和require实现, 5. 一些框架和组件 框架 我较量喜好的是 Laravel, 前提判定和轮回(if else、for、foreach、while) 引入或担任自其他文件

(编辑:宁德站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

热点阅读